Two decades after his breakout album It’s Time, five-time Grammy Award winner Michael Bublé sits down with Willie Geist at New York’s Blue Note Jazz Club to reflect on his journey from Canadian fishing boats to global fame. Bublé opens up about the grandfather who introduced him to Frank Sinatra, Louis Armstrong and Ella Fitzgerald, the early gigs that shaped his craft, and the moment that changed everything in his career. He also talks about his love for Christmas music, the perspective he gained after his son’s illness, and his return as a coach on NBC’s The Voice, where he’s chasing his third straight win.
